  • The preparation of $Ti_{50}Cu_{28}Ni_{15}Sn_7$ metallic glass composite powders was accomplished by the mechanical alloying of a pure Ti, Cu, Ni, Sn and carbon nanotube (CNT) powder mixture after 8 h milling. In the ball-milled composites, the initial CNT particles were dissolved in the Ti-based alloy glassy matrix. The bulk metallic glass composite was successfully prepared by vacuum hot pressing the as-milled CNT/$Ti_{50}Cu_{28}Ni_{15}Sn_7$ metallic glass composite powders. A significant hardness increase with the CNT additions was observed for the consolidated composite compacts.

  • [ $Mg_{55}Y_{15}Cu_{30}$ ] metallic glass powders were prepared by the mechanical alloying of pure Mg, Y, and Cu after 10 h of milling. The thermal stability of these $Mg_{55}Y_{15}Cu_{30}$ amorphous powders was investigated using the differential scanning calorimeter (DSC). $T_g$, $T_x$, and ${\Delta}T_x$ are 442 K, 478 K, and 36 K, respectively. The as-milled $Mg_{55}Y_{15}Cu_{30}$ powders were then consolidated by vacuum hot pressing into disk compacts with a diameter and thickness of 10 mm and 1 mm, respectively. This yielded bulk $Mg_{55}Y_{15}Cu_{30}$ metallic glass with nanocrystalline precipitates homogeneously embedded in a highly dense glassy matrix. The pressure applied during consolidation can enhance thermal stability and prolong the existence of amorphous phase within $Mg_{55}Y_{15}Cu_{30}$ powders.

  • Half-Heusler alloys are a potential thermoelectric material for use in high-temperature applications. In an attempt to produce half-Heusler thermoelectric materials with fine microstructures, TiCoSb was synthesized by the mechanical alloying of stoichiometric elemental powder compositions and then consolidated by vacuum hot pressing. The phase transformations during the mechanical alloying and hot consolidation process were investigated using XRD and SEM. A single-phase, half- Heusler allow was successfully produced by the mechanical alloying process, but a minor portion of the second phase of the CoSb formation was observed after the vacuum hot pressing. The thermoelectric properties as a function of the temperature were evaluated for the hot-pressed specimens. The Seebeck coefficients in the test range showed negative values, representing n-type conductivity, and the absolute value was found to be relatively low due to the existence of the second phase. It is shown that the electrical conductivity is relatively high and that the thermal conductivities are compatibly low in MA TiCoSb. The maximum ZT value was found to be relatively low in the test temperature range, possibly due to the lower Seebeck coefficient. The Hall mobility value appeared to be quite low, leading to the lower value of Seebeck coefficient. Thus, it is likely that the single phase produced by mechanical alloying process will show much higher ZT values after an excess Ti addition. It is also believed that further property enhancement can be obtained if appropriate dopants are selectively introduced into this MA TiCoSb System.

  • Type I clathrate $Ba_8Al_{16}Si_{30}$ was produced by arc melting and hot pressing and thermoelectric properties were investigated. Negative Seebeck coefficient at all temperatures measured, which means that the majority carriers are electrons. Electrical conductivity decreased by increasing temperature and thermal conductivity was 0.012 W/cmK at room temperature and dimensionless thermoelectric figure of merit (ZT) was 0.01 at 873K.

  • Fe-doped skutterudite $CoSb_3$ with a nominal composition of $Fe_{x}Co_{4-x}Sb_{12}(0\;{\le}\;x\;{\le}\;2.5)$ has been synthesized by mechanical alloying (MA) of elemental powders, followed by hot pressing. Phase transformations during mechanical alloying and hot pressing were systematically investigated using XRD. Single phase skutterudite was successfully produced by vacuum hot pressing using as-milled powders without subsequent annealing. However, second phase in the form of marcasite structure $FeSb_2$ was found to exist in case of $x\;{\ge}\;2$, suggesting the solubility limit of Fe with Co in this system. Thermoelectric properties as functions of temperature and Fe contents were evaluated for the hot pressed specimens. Fe substitution up to x=1.5 with Co in $Fe_{x}Co_{4-x}Sb_{12}$ appeared to increase thermoelectric figure of merit (ZT) and the maximum ZT was found to be 0.78 at 525K in this study.

  • In our previous studies, continuous SiC fiber-reinforced SiC-matrix composites ($SiC_f$/SiC) had been fabricated by two different slurry infiltration methods: vacuum infiltration and electrophoretic deposition (EPD). 12 wt% of $Al_2O_3-Y_2O_3$-MgO with respect to SiC powder was used as additives for liquid-phase assisted sintering. After hot pressing at $1750^{\circ}C$ under 20 MPa for 2 h in Ar atmosphere, a high composite density could be achieved for both cases, whereas the problems such as large grain size and non-uniform distribution of liquid phase were observed, which was resulted in the relatively poor mechanical properties of composites. Therefore, efforts have been made to reduce the grain growth during the sintering, including the optimization for hot pressing condition and utilization of spark plasma sintering using a SiC monolith. Based on the results, spark plasma sintering was found to be effective method in decreasing the amount of sintering additive, time and grain growth, which will be explained in comparison to the results of hot pressing in this paper.

  • The thermoelectric and transport properties of Ti-doped FeVSb half-Heusler alloys were studied in this study. $FeV_{1-x}Ti_xSb$ (0.1 < x < 0.5) half-Heusler alloys were synthesized by mechanical alloying process and subsequent vacuum hot pressing. After vacuum hot pressing, a near singe phase with a small fraction of second phase was obtained in this experiment. Investigation of microstructure revealed that both grain and particle sizes were decreased on doping which would influence on thermal conductivity. No foreign elements pick up from the vial was seen during milling process. Thermoelectric properties were investigated as a function of temperature and doping level. The absolute value of Seebeck coefficient showed transition from negative to positive with increasing doping concentrations ($x{\geq}0.3$). Electrical conductivity, Seebeck coefficient and power factor increased with the increasing amount of Ti contents. The lattice thermal conductivity decreased considerably, possibly due to the mass disorder and grain boundary scattering. All of these turned out to increase in power factor significantly. As a result, the thermoelectric figure of merit increased comprehensively with Ti doping for this experiment, resulting in maximum thermoelectric figure of merit for $FeV_{0.7}Ti_{0.3}Sb$ at 658 K.

  • In this paper, PLZT Ceramics were fabricated by two stage sintering method whose first stage vacuum hot pressing and second stage PbO atmosphere sintering. Using Graphite Mould instead of Alumina Mould in first stage prevented the adhision between PLZT substrate and the mould. The grain sizes of PLZT Ceramics were controlled by varying the hot pressing time and second sintering time.
